“Universal Design” - Public Toilet for ALLAll

At a time when people around the world are awakening to Universal and Accessible Design as an important tool towards achieving human right through the enactment of the momentous UN Convention on the Rights of People with Disabilities (UN-CRPD). The sense of opportunity and real need for change is greater than ever. However, Nepal is still far behind in aspects related to Universal Design and Accessibility. The provision of equitable physical accessibility to public infrastructure for persons with disabilities is continuously being neglected.
